John Charles Levett Williams - Charlcombe (Lyalldale)

Date: 2006

From: New Zealand Century Farm and Station Program :New Zealand Century Farm and Station Award applications

Reference: MS-Papers-8640-58

Description: The papers consist of: Application form submitted by John Williams; history of the Williams family of `Charlcombe', Lyalldale, South Canterbury; photographs of the farm and family; certificates of title and maps. Original owner of the farm was Arthur Cuthbert Williams who purchased 584 acres in 1901. In 2007 the property was owned by his great-grandson, J C L Williams. In 2006 the property was awarded the New Zealand Century Farm and Station award to mark over 100 years of continuous ownership by one family. See also addendum dated 2011-2014, MS-Papers-12040. [Mantell, Walter Baldock Durrant] 1820-1895 :Cavendish Bay &c [et cetera] & town of Lyt...

Date: 1849

From: Mantell, Walter Baldock Durrant, 1820-1895 :Scrapbook. 1840-1872.

By: Mantell, Walter Baldock Durrant (Hon), 1820-1895

Reference: C-103-074-1

Description: View looking down into Lyttelton Harbour from the Sumner Road area, taking in Lyttelton, with its few houses marked, as well as Rapaki and Cass Bays and looking towards Governor's Bay. The drawing forms a panoramic view with C-103-075-1, which includes Quail Island. Caption points out sites of other bays and early buildings in Lyttelton, including the (Canterbury Association) Agent's house (Godley's house), the house occupied by Torlesse, Cridland and Mantell, also 'Godley & Ballard's', 'Fraser and heads of departments', 'Men's hut and smithy'. The drawing is on two separate pieces of paper and forms thecentre and right sections of a panorama with C-103-075-1 'Quail Island' Quantity: 2 drawing(s). [Mantell, Walter Baldock Durrant] 1820-1895 :Arowenua Tarahaoa [1848]

Date: 1848

From: Mantell, Walter Baldock Durrant 1820-1895: [Sketches]

By: Mantell, Walter Baldock Durrant (Hon), 1820-1895

Reference: E-281-q-023

Description: A single-storey house surrounded by a fence, with a shed or further house beyond it, a conical hill and other foothills of the Southern Alps in the near background. A figure with a pole over one shoulder walks along a path to the right towards the house. The house is surrounded by cultivated fields. Another building and possibly a haystack are to the right. Arowhenua is close to modern Temuka, South Canterbury, on the Opihi River. Tarahaoa is the Maori name for Mount Peel, possibly the conical hill behind the house. Mount Peel is some 40 km distant from Arowhenua and appears closer in this view than the location of modern Arowhenua would suggest. The name Arowhenua was applied to a larger area in 1848 than in modern times Other Titles - Arowhenua Quantity: 1 drawing(s). Physical Description: Pencil works, 57 x 103 mm
